fontforge

    0热度

    1回答

    fontforge(表面上也称为“硬币”,在UI中显示为正方形)中的拐角点可具有零个,一个或两个句柄来控制出线的方向。这个事实是nicely explained in the manual,但我无法找到关于如何控制手柄数量的任何提示。 如何更改角点的Bézier手柄数量? 在我的具体情况下,我在两个角之间有一条直线,我想将此线改为“向外凸出”一点。我试图在两个角之间添加一个“曲线点”,但这给了我一

    0热度

    1回答

    在'Encoding'菜单下的FontForge GUI中,有一个选项'Detach Glyphs'。我可以用Python做到这一点吗? 更具体地说,在我的Python脚本中,当我删除附加到另一个字形的字形时,两者都被清除。我怎样才能避免这种情况?

    0热度

    1回答

    我正在使用fontforge创建带有连字的字体,其中一些字体使用了字体。我可以使用纯字母的连字来正常工作,但是,当我使用数字时,会引发错误。 这是我的代码至今: import fontforge font = fontforge.font() font.encoding = 'UnicodeFull' font.version = '1.0' font.weight = 'Regula

    0热度

    1回答

    我想知道它是否可以合并“”作为雕文。 - 背后的想法是:使“100”与任何2位数字相同 - 我只需要能够操纵的数字“100”。 - 如果我将“100”作为自己的字形,我可以制作自己的“100”或使用 进行调整 - 我知道它可能包含2个字符,称为字距,但仅适用于一对! - 所以我的问题是使它与3个字符。或简单地有我自己的“100”编辑 或更简单:如何结合unicode字符。 也许它甚至没有可能,或者

    1热度

    1回答

    我正在尝试使用Fontforge脚本将.otf字体转换为.ttf字体(使用Postscript轮廓)。 默认选项通过Truetype轮廓转换为.ttf。 如果有人能提供一些方向,我将不胜感激。

    0热度

    1回答

    我有一个组合变音符号不合并的字体。一些应用程序(Adobe Illustrator)正确显示字体,一个应用程序分别显示字符。不幸的是,这个应用程序存在于我的控制之外的服务器上,这使得测试变得困难。当我切换到另一种字体(Arial Unicode MS)时,组合的变音符号正确显示。此应用程序不支持OpenType字体。 例如,U+00EA(ê)加上U+0323(下面的点)应该呈现为一个e,其中的回音

    0热度

    1回答

    我想文本标签添加到我的FontForge字母,这样我就可以在HTML中引用它们的名字,而不是实际的字母或符号。例如,谷歌材料设计字体有很多符号,你可以通过一个文本标签(cloud_queue),或一个实体代码(&#xE2C2;)是指他们。小材料云图标是这样的: <i class="material-icons">cloud_queue</i> or (for IE9 or below) <i

    1热度

    1回答

    我有一个带有一些连字错误的字体。这在my Android application中造成问题。我想删除连字。我如何在FontForge中做到这一点? 这个问题是相关的,但它是相反的。 Fontforge Scripting how to add ligatures for a glyph 这是一个自答题。我的答案如下。

    0热度

    1回答

    不久前,我在Mac OS X Yosemite上通过grunt-webfont将glyphicon生成到CSS tff。现在我添加了一个新图标,但出于某种原因,图标在新的运行后不再对齐。 的图标应该是这样的: 的图像1图标的大小也是错误的,25x110但在图像2 50×50,因为他们应该。 例子中的CSS如下: .icon { font-family: "icons"; fon

    0热度

    1回答

    为了检测字体是否包含javascript中的某个特定字符我已经决定最好的方法是让所有unicode字符具有完全零宽度空格的后备字体。这种字体可以让我轻松地检查自己的存在情况,以及任何其他字体中存在的任何字符(除了conrtol字符)。我只会检查字符的宽度。 你知道这样的字体是否已经存在? 使用FontForge和脚本编写应该很简单。但是我很难进入FontForge和Unicode文档。如果有人在F